jerryc127 / hexo-theme-butterfly

🦋 A Hexo Theme: Butterfly
https://butterfly.js.org
Apache License 2.0
7.05k stars 1.27k forks source link

代码块缩进问题 #104

Closed Coolkkmeat closed 4 years ago

Coolkkmeat commented 4 years ago

1

如图,工具是vscode,缩进方式4空格,win10 chrome,hexo3.1.0,butterfly最新dev。 在vscode的插件中,代码缩进一切正常。而到了博客里面(hexo s)就会显示混乱,并且难以控制。 代码块中的代码用过java、xml之类的也是有这个问题。

感谢您。

jerryc127 commented 4 years ago

发一下你 hexo 的package.json

Coolkkmeat commented 4 years ago

发一下你 hexo 的package.json

{
  "name": "hexo-site",
  "version": "0.0.0",
  "private": true,
  "scripts": {
    "build": "hexo generate",
    "clean": "hexo clean",
    "deploy": "hexo deploy",
    "server": "hexo server"
  },
  "hexo": {
    "version": "4.1.1"
  },
  "dependencies": {
    "hexo": "^4.0.0",
    "hexo-browsersync": "^0.3.0",
    "hexo-deployer-git": "^2.1.0",
    "hexo-generator-archive": "^1.0.0",
    "hexo-generator-category": "^1.0.0",
    "hexo-generator-index-pin-top": "^0.2.2",
    "hexo-generator-tag": "^1.0.0",
    "hexo-renderer-ejs": "^1.0.0",
    "hexo-renderer-marked": "^2.0.0",
    "hexo-renderer-pug": "^1.0.0",
    "hexo-renderer-stylus": "^1.1.0",
    "hexo-server": "^1.0.0",
    "hexo-wordcount": "^6.0.1"
  }
}
jerryc127 commented 4 years ago

如果你是因为代码空格缩进问题 我建议你到hexo那去反馈 因为主题并不负责渲染代码。。

Coolkkmeat commented 4 years ago

如果你是因为代码空格缩进问题 我建议你到hexo那去反馈 因为主题并不负责渲染代码。。

好的,感谢您。

Coolkkmeat commented 4 years ago

问题已经解决。 方法如下(VSCODE):点击下面现在的缩进样式,将缩进转换为制表符,使用TAB缩进(4)。即可正常。

1976083684 commented 1 year ago

问题已经解决。 方法如下(VSCODE):点击下面现在的缩进样式,将缩进转换为制表符,使用TAB缩进(4)。即可正常。

怎么弄的,这个好麻烦,想要关闭这个4个空格变成代码块

1976083684 commented 1 year ago

问题已经解决。 方法如下(VSCODE):点击下面现在的缩进样式,将缩进转换为制表符,使用TAB缩进(4)。即可正常。

TAB缩进(4),还是会变成代码块,好烦恼,我的文章是从typora移植过来的,基本文章开头都是4个空格缩进,结果文章都变成代码块了,欸

Coolkkmeat commented 1 year ago

问题已经解决。 方法如下(VSCODE):点击下面现在的缩进样式,将缩进转换为制表符,使用TAB缩进(4)。即可正常。

TAB缩进(4),还是会变成代码块,好烦恼,我的文章是从typora移植过来的,基本文章开头都是4个空格缩进,结果文章都变成代码块了,欸

我现在是手动打4个空格,就可以正常缩进了